A Journey of Fajro

This is a paranormal book dealing with vampires. If you are fond of mystery, this one is for you. The character of the protagonist's father was kept as mysterious. Like why does he spend time with his child? How he dies? All these questions will arouse your level of curiosity to a greater extent. However, I do feel use of punctuations can make the book a great piece. Punctuations is an essential part, and throws an overall impact on the hook like how do you want your readers to read the lines. It helps in providing a better experience. In my opinion, a basic introduction like providing the physical appearance, name, or at least the sex of the protagonist can make the whole thing more interesting (to be honest, I was confused about the gender of the MC). You are doing great, but I think dialogues can be more smooth. You can proofread your work a number of times before publishing to avoid the mistakes. And, you can also check out books from very professional authors to get a better idea (best option). All the best in your journey!
